Market Overview

Current Median Home Prices and Recent Trends

As of 2023, the median sale price for homes in Los Altos is approximately $3.5 million. While the broader Santa Clara County sees a slight decrease in home prices, Los Altos continues to maintain its premium market status, with prices holding steady due to high demand and limited inventory. Homes typically sell within 15 days, reflecting a competitive environment.

In comparison, the median listing price in Santa Clara County is around $1.6 million, with homes selling after an average of 12 days on the market. The per-square-foot price in Los Altos is higher, emphasizing its status as a luxury market.

Neighborhoods & Lifestyle

Popular Neighborhoods and Their Characteristics

  • North Los Altos: Known for its spacious properties and proximity to downtown, this neighborhood offers a mix of historic charm and modern amenities.
  • South Los Altos: Family-friendly with excellent schools, South Los Altos is ideal for those seeking a peaceful environment with convenient access to shopping and dining.
  • Country Club: Featuring luxurious estates and scenic views, this neighborhood appeals to those desiring privacy and an exclusive lifestyle.

Los Altos neighborhoods offer something for everyone, from luxury homes in Country Club to more accessible options in South Los Altos, making it a versatile choice for various buyers.

Schools & Families

School Ratings and Family Amenities

Los Altos is served by the highly acclaimed Los Altos School District and Mountain View-Los Altos Union High School District, both recognized for their academic excellence. Some of the top-rated schools include:

  • Los Altos High School: Rated 9/10 by GreatSchools, known for its rigorous academic programs.
  • Gardner Bullis Elementary: Offers a strong community focus and innovative learning approaches.

Families in Los Altos benefit from numerous amenities, including expansive parks, community centers, and family-friendly events. The city's commitment to education and community well-being makes it a top choice for families.

Investment Outlook

Long-Term Appreciation Potential

Despite a slight cooling in the broader market, Los Altos continues to be a sound investment due to its desirable location and limited housing supply. The city's proximity to major tech companies ensures ongoing demand, with property values expected to appreciate steadily over the next five years.

Investors should consider single-family homes in North Los Altos for long-term growth, while condos in downtown areas offer potential rental income opportunities.
